Hi Jack, I purchased it from Flightsim.to. Go to their site, then go to payware and select boats. There are ten products available at the moment. I went for the Yacht and Sailboat pack V2.1 by Marine RM.Just unzip and put them in the community folder. I have used two of the four so far and they are OK.
